Rock Springs has been called the "Home of 56 Nationalities" for its large immigrant population at the turn of the century. The diversity of that population has resulted in a similar diversity in the city's dining options. Sure, cowboy grub is still abundant, and who doesn't love a great burger or a juicy steak? But the locals also love great sushi. It's true as in the heart of the Wild West is great eastern fare. The rainbow roll looks as good as it tastes. Try something new with the seaweed salad, or put the tempura to the test. From the other end of the world is authentic Mexican cuisine. Sizzling fajitas are always a crowd favorite, but if you're feeling adventurous, go for the stuffed sopapillas.
